Логотип exploitDog
Консоль
Логотип exploitDog

exploitDog

github логотип

GHSA-6gx3-4362-rf54

Опубликовано: 17 мар. 2026
Источник: github
Github: Прошло ревью
CVSS4: 6.3

Описание

astral-tokio-tar insufficiently validates PAX extensions during extraction

Impact

In versions 0.5.6 and earlier of astral-tokio-tar, malformed PAX extensions were silently skipped when parsing tar archives. This silent skipping (rather than rejection) of invalid PAX extensions could be used as a building block for a parser differential, for example by having astral-tokio-tar silently skip a malformed GNU “long link” extension so that a subsequent parser would misinterpret the extension.

In practice, exploiting this behavior in astral-tokio-tar requires a secondary misbehaving tar parser, i.e. one that insufficiently validates malformed PAX extensions and interprets them rather than skipping or erroring on them. Consequently this advisory is considered low-severity within astral-tokio-tar itself, as it requires a separate vulnerability against any unrelated tar parser.

Patches

Versions 0.6.0 and newer of astral-tokio-tar reject invalid PAX extensions, rather than silently skipping them.

Workarounds

Users are advised to upgrade to version 0.6.0 or newer to address this advisory.

Most users should experience no breaking changes as a result of the patch above. Some users who attempt to extract poorly constructed tar files may experience errors; users should re-construct their tar files with a conforming tar parser.

Attribution

  • Sergei Zimmerman (@xokdvium)

Пакеты

Наименование

astral-tokio-tar

rust
Затронутые версииВерсия исправления

<= 0.5.6

0.6.0

EPSS

Процентиль: 5%
0.0002
Низкий

6.3 Medium

CVSS4

Дефекты

CWE-436

Связанные уязвимости

msrc
6 дней назад

astral-tokio-tar insufficiently validates PAX extensions during extraction

EPSS

Процентиль: 5%
0.0002
Низкий

6.3 Medium

CVSS4

Дефекты

CWE-436